Abstract
The utility model discloses a kind of textiles with heat transfer unit (HTU), including the upper woven face bed of material, the lower woven face bed of material and electrothermal layer, the electric heating is placed between the woven face bed of material and the lower woven face bed of material, there is connecting band between the upper woven face bed of material and the lower woven face bed of material, the connecting band is equipped with aperture, the aperture is equipped with jack head fixing seat, the electrothermal layer is set as flexible electrothermal membrane, the flexible electrothermal membrane connects jack head by power supply line, the jack head is detachably mounted in jack head fixing seat, zipper is equipped between the upper woven face bed of material and the lower woven face bed of material.The textile for having the function of heat transfer unit (HTU) not only effectively realizes textile fabric heat transfer, but also separation electric calorifie installation easy to disassemble, thus facilitates washing, reduces security risk, improves heat-transfer effect, improve users'comfort, practicability is high.

And at present in the textile used, it much needs with specific function, such as heating and heat preserving function etc., especially
As mattress, perhaps cushion is especially suitable during the cold season but many cushion or electric blanket with heating function at present
Its internal electric calorifie installation cannot all be decoupled, thus not be suitable for washing, it is inconvenient to use.
Summary of the invention
(1) technical problems to be solved
In order to overcome the shortage of prior art, it is proposed that the textile that one kind is easily washed, solving existing textile cannot decouple
Electric calorifie installation and the problem of wash.

A kind of working principle for textile with heat transfer unit (HTU) that the present invention mentions: it in actual use, is led by band
The triangle plug of electric post holes is plugged on jack head, and the plug of the triangle plug power supply line other end is then plugged on commercial power socket
On then power on, flexible electrothermal membrane is heated and is conducted heat on the woven face bed of material of top and the bottom, then play heat transfer make
With, and when needing to wash textile, it is only necessary to it unzips, then pulls open velcro or snap-fastener or magnetic structure, after
And the upper woven face bed of material is separated with the lower woven face bed of material, then by iron block with positioning magnetic patch separate, retell flexible electrothermal membrane from
It removes on telescopic rod, finally takes out entire flexible electrothermal membrane between the upper and lower woven face bed of material, while by jack head from jack
It is disassembled in head fixing seat, completes the separation of entire flexible electrothermal membrane, after drying textile washing, by above-mentioned opposite
The step of the installation of flexible electrothermal membrane and textile fabric is integrated and is continued to use.
